The new season of the HBO crime drama follows Jodie Foster’s Liz Danvers and Cali Reis’ Evangeline Navarro as they investigate a mass disappearance at a remote research base in Alaska. true detective night land Reviews from critics have been largely positive, but Pizzolatto has been vocal about his distaste for the new direction.
After resharing negative posts about the show. true detective night land Pizzolatto has now taken to Instagram to respond to the criticism he faced over the decision. Check out his post below.

TRUE DETECTIVE Collective Post – This is the place for all the trolling/support/infighting about True Detective and the absolute moral depravity and misogyny of anyone who didn’t think it was good. Let’s move these screeds away from my posts about wives, true love, and the death of my father.
I’d say “be polite,” but there’s no room for civility when criticism of a TV show points to some kind of Hitlerian evil that needs to be eradicated. Now let the tide flow. Satire is welcome, have a nice day ♥️
The maximum number of comments is 1350. This seems to be enough space for this artificial proxy culture clash. Alas, all things must come to an end. Boredom is real. Fill your stomach as much as possible. And again, have a nice day.

Each season in this anthology series, a different detective is forced to confront terrifying truths about their town and themselves. Regardless of the setting or characters, each detective must unravel lies and clues to solve the chilling mysteries around them.
